On Tue, 21 Jul 1998, David Mandelstam wrote: > Hi there, > > We have written a WAN driver for FreeBSD, and I wanted to announce it > on our web site. What is your policy as regards the FreeBSD > logo/graphic? Can we use it? The daemon is copyright Kirk McKusick, you'll have to ask him. Info is on http://www.freebsd.org/daemon.html. He's very nice about it though, make sure you mention FreeBSD.
